Throughout August and September, Spazju Kreattiv Cinema will present a new production following the story of one woman’s struggle in modern-day France
Spazju Kreattiv is known for its eclectic and inspiring film screenings, providing a vital platform for Malta’s contemporary arts scene and discerning independent film aficionados. This month, the centre will present Her Way, a film set in France telling the story of a woman called Marie, and her harrowing journey to provide financial support for her son’s education.
Showing on Friday 26 August at 7:30pm and starring Laure Calamy (Call my Agent!), the production details Marie’s personal sacrifices and struggles in her venture to ensure her son’s future at an elite private catering school, and the lengths she is willing to go to achieve it.
A selected film at the Glasgow Film Festival and Tallinn Black Nights Film Festival, Cécile Ducrocq’s debut feature Her Way takes a bold look at the life of sex workers, and the discrimination and unique challenges they face.
